1
0
Fork 0
forked from forks/qmk_firmware
qmk_firmware/keyboards/kin80
2024-04-23 19:47:30 +10:00
..
blackpill103 Migrate build target markers to keyboard.json (#23293) 2024-03-30 11:31:50 +00:00
blackpill401 Change to development_board (#21695) 2024-04-23 19:47:30 +10:00
blackpill411 Change to development_board (#21695) 2024-04-23 19:47:30 +10:00
keymaps/default Remove obvious user keymaps, keyboards/{i,j,k}* edition (#23102) 2024-02-18 08:20:57 +00:00
micro Migrate build target markers to keyboard.json (#23293) 2024-03-30 11:31:50 +00:00
info.json Migrate features and LTO from rules.mk to data driven (#23307) 2024-03-30 10:57:30 +00:00
readme.md RESET -> QK_BOOT keyboard readme (#18110) 2022-08-20 11:34:17 +01:00
rules.mk Migrate features and LTO from rules.mk to data driven (#23307) 2024-03-30 10:57:30 +00:00

Kin80

Kin80 controller

Kin80 is a set of replacement PCBs and switch mounting plates for Kinesis Contoured keyboards.

There are 4 versions of the controller PCB, which correspond to the subfolder names:

  • 'micro': rev. 1.1 (obsolete) used Arduino Micro board.
  • 'blackpill103': rev. 1.2 (obsolete) used 'Black Pill' boards with STM32F103C8T6 MCU.
  • 'blackpill401' and 'blackpill411'. Latest Kin80 PCB revisions (1.3+) use WeAct Studio STM32F401 or STM32F411 boards. They are pin compatible with each other, but use different MCUs.

Make example for this keyboard (after setting up your build environment):

`qmk compile -kb kin80 -km default`

See the build environment setup and the make instructions for more information. Brand new to QMK? Start with our Complete Newbs Guide.

Default version is 'blackpill401'. If you need to build a firmware for STM32F411, use 'blackpill411' version, e.g.:

qmk compile -kb kin80:blackpill411 -km default

Bootloader

Enter the bootloader in 3 ways:

  • Bootmagic reset: Hold down the the top left key and plug in the keyboard.
  • Physical reset button. Hold 'boot0' button on MCU board, press 'reset', then release 'boot0'.
  • Keycode in layout: Press the key mapped to QK_BOOT if it is available